Environmental Significance: Protecting Our Natural Resources
One of the key historical events noted on this day is the designation of Lehman Caves National Monument in 1922, which eventually became part of Great Basin National Park. This monument protects not only the longest-known cave in Nevada but also some of the world's oldest living trees.
